Baby rattle with miniature aryballos, inspired by an aryballoid vase. The aryballos is decorated with spiral motifs on the body. The vessel was used as container for perfume or oil mainly by women but also by male athlets. The aryballoid vases were particularly popular in the Archaic period and the Early Cycladic Period. Our collection of accessories includes a guitar pick with an engraved depiction of Apollo's lyre. Apollo was the patron god of music and arts. The lyre is considered the "national" musical instrument of the ancient Greeks. The design of the lyre is inspired by a representation of Apollo and his lyre on an attic white-ground lekythos (vase), which was found at Delphi and is probably attributed to Pistoxenos Painter.

Anchor from a Hydraic "nava" (ship) from the years of the Greek Revolution 1821. Of the Admiralty Pattern (British Naval). An exhibit at the Historical Archive Naval Museum of Hydra. Handmade solid brass copy with brown patina on acrylic base.

An Archaeology of Representations: Ancient Greek Vase-Painting and Contemporary Methodologies offers original approaches to vase-paintings of archaic and classical Greece, with an emphasis on the semiotics of ancient modes of representation. Written by an international group of eminent scholars, the essays in this book address methodological questions and propose wide-ranging interpretive arguments for the study of a large number of images from the rich and complex corpus of ancient Greek vase-painting.
